Job description

ECS Engineering Services Ltd. is seeking a highly organised Work Planner to oversee resource allocation and activity scheduling across all departments. This role is pivotal in ensuring efficient project execution, effective utilisation of resources, and optimal planning for fabrication, project works, and planned preventive maintenance (PPM).

The Work Planner will act as the central hub for planning activities, collaborating with operations, commercial, procurement, and engineering teams to optimise workflows and maximise cost efficiency.

  • Strong experience in workforce, resource, and project planning, ideally within the construction or engineering sectors.
  • Proven ability to plan, allocate, and monitor resources across multiple projects simultaneously.
  • Knowledge of NEC4 contract frameworks and their impact on planning and resource management.
  • Strong working knowledge of planning software, including Microsoft Project.
  • Excellent problem-solving and critical-thinking skills, with the ability to optimise resource utilisation.
  • Strong analytical skills with excellent attention to detail.
  • Exceptional communication and coordination skills, enabling effective cross-departmental collaboration.
  •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, deadline-driven environment.
  • Ability to introduce new ideas and drive continuous improvement within the scope of the role.
  • Recognises the importance of teamwork and promotes a positive team ethos.
  • Experience in planned preventative maintenance (PPM) scheduling within engineering or asset management industries.
  • Proficiency in data analytics and reporting tools such as Power BI, Tableau, or similar platforms.
  • Familiarity with lean planning methodologies to improve operational efficiency.
